Israel Faces Accusation of Genocide as South Africa Brings Case to U.N. Court

Arguing to a packed courtroom at the International Court of Justice in The Hague, South African lawyers cited the words of Israeli officials as evidence in their case. Israel has categorically denied the accusation.
